Unfolding in a series of diary entries, letters, newspaper articles, and ships' logs, Bram Stoker's renowned tale of terror opens with young lawyer Jonathan Harker journeying to Transylvania to meet with the mysterious Count Dracula. There, Harker discovers his nobleman client is a bloodthirsty vampire on the hunt for new prey. After imprisoning Harker in his castle, Dracula travels to England, where he encounters Harkerβs fiancΓ©e, Mina Murray, her tragic friend Lucy Westenra, and the formidable Doctor Abraham van Helsing. What transpires in London is a terrifying and haunting battle against an unspeakable and seemingly indestructible evil.

About the Author
Bram Stoker (1847-1912) grew up listening to his mother's tales of blood-drinking fairies and vampires rising from their graves. He later managed the Lyceum Theatre in London and worked as a civil servant and a newspaper editor and reporter. Dracula, his best-known work, was published in 1897.
